Hi, This in context of using Chimera to view *ccp4 format electron density maps. How does Chimera 'Threshold Level' ('Level' in Volume viewer) equate or relate to sigma level reported by some other programs. For example a 'Level' of 0.4 seems like a map contoured at 1.5 sigma or so. I was wondering if someone could point out how these two are related, more precisely. Thanks Veer Sandeep Bhatt
